  •  QTL Experiment in Brief
    Animals:Animals were South African mutton merino x Gansu alpine fine wool crossbred sheep.
     Breeds associated:
    Design:Animals were genotyped for five SNPs in the FGF5 gene and analyzed for SNP association with wool and growth traits.
    Analysis:A least-squares method with a linear model was used.
    Software:SPSS 22.0
